Africa: WHO Urges Caution As Countries Ease Lockdowns

[Africa Renewal] Three months after the first case of COVID-19 was detected in sub-Saharan Africa, the region has made progress in tackling the virus. Many countries implemented lockdowns and key public health measures early and these appear to have helped slow down the spread of the disease. However, there are concerns that if these measures are relaxed too quickly, COVID-19 cases could start increasing rapidly. via LATEST NEWS

JUST IN: English Premier League To Resume June 17 Amid COVID-19

English Premier League soccer ball The English Premier League will resume on June 17 after the 20 clubs in the division agreed “in principle” to return to play and complete the remainder of the 2019-20 season that was halted in mid-March due to the Coronavirus outbreak. It was revealed that Manchester City versus Arsenal will be one of the first matches to be played. United States President, Trump, Signs Executive Order Regulating Social Media After Twitter Fact-checked His Tweets

U.S. President Donald Trump holds up a front page of the New York Post as he speaks to reporters while signing an executive order on social media companies in the Oval Office of the White House in Washington, U.S., May 28, 2020. Trump's Tweets President Donald Trump of the United States on Thursday signed an executive order seeking to limit the broad legal protection that federal law currently provides to social-media and other online platforms. This is coming days after Twitter called two of his tweets "potentially misleading".  Speaking from the Oval Office ahead of signing the order, Trump accused Twitter of acting as an editor “with a viewpoint” and described the platform’s fact-check of his tweets as “political activism”.  He said he would delete his Twitter account “in a heartbeat” if he felt the news media were fair to him. Kebbi Discharges Last Two COVID-19 Patients After Recovery

Kebbi State government has discharged the last two COVID-19 patients in its isolation centre after recovery. This was disclosed by the Task Force Chairman on COVID-19, who is also the Commissioner for Health, Jafar Muhammed, who said follow up tests conducted on them came back negative. He stated that with the latest discharge, the state no longer had any active case of COVID-19. "Our two remaining COVID-19 patients at the isolation center in Kebbi Medical Center, Kalgo, are discharged today. "So, by implication, they are free to be integrated back into the mainstream society because their results turned out to be negative after their two weeks stay in the isolation centre," Muhammed said. Katsina Governor, Masari, Lifts Ban On Juma’at, Church Services

Kastina State Governor Bello Masari Governor Bello Masari of Kastina State has announced the temporary lifting of lockdown throughout the state every Friday. Masari also lifted the ban on religious gatherings and inter-local government movements across the state.  Kastina State Governor Bello Masari The governor said the decision was to enable Muslim and Christian faithful observe their weekly religious activities while every Friday of the week was declared lockdown-free for residents to get essential items.
